  • the present invention relates to a wristwatch of substantially rectangular shape comprising a box enclosing a movement, a bracelet of which a first strand is fixed on a first side of the box and a second strand is fixed on a side opposite to the first, and two flaps sliding on the box and able to be opened or closed to respectively reveal or hide said box by manual action exerted on these flaps, guide and retaining means being implemented to secure each of said flaps to the box.
  • the document CH 144 055 refers to a timepiece including a watch window. This timepiece is characterized by two sliding shutters normally covering the window and guided in two slides arranged in the box.
  • the document CH 337 138 is another example that can be cited where the described wristwatch has a sliding lid.
  • the housing is rectangular and has at its ends two studs to each of which is articulated one end of a bracelet.
  • the cover has an arcuate cross-section, the longitudinal edges of this cover being engaged in guide grooves, which hold the cover, each formed in the outer side of a longitudinal flange of the middle part flanking the window of the ice protection.
  • In the outer flank of each flange is hollowed a longitudinal groove into which a strip formed in the longitudinal edge of the arc-shaped lid penetrates.
  • the groove and the strip preferably have a triangular section.
  • the disadvantages mentioned above can be greatly reduced if it is possible to reduce the friction effect of the elements in the presence, in particular by providing different retaining means of the guide means, the construction being arranged so that the Frictional forces essentially affect only the retaining means, which is the main object of the present invention.
  • the documents consulted on the retaining means of the flap on the box are confused with the means for guiding said flap on said box.
  • the invention is characterized in that said guide and retaining means are distinct from one another and that means are used to exert under each flap a vertical force tending to apply said flap against said restraint means.
  • the wristwatch shown on the Figures 1 and 2 has a substantially rectangular shape. It comprises a box 1 enclosing a movement (not shown) surmounted by a dial 30 on which move needles hours 31 and minutes 32.
  • the watch also includes a bracelet, a first strand 2 is fixed on a first side 3 of the box 1 and a second strand 4 is fixed on a second side 5 opposite to the first side.
  • Two shutters 6 and 7 slide on the box 1 and can to be opened or closed to respectively reveal ( figure 2 ) or hide ( figure 1 ) the box 1, this by manual action exerted on the shutters 6 and 7.
  • each of the flaps 6 and 7 (here the flap 6) is secured to the box 1 by guide means 8 and retaining 9, which means will be described in detail below.
  • the flap wristwatch is distinguished here from the prior art by the fact that the guide means 8 are distinct from the retaining means as is clearly shown in FIG. figure 4 , which allows each of the flaps 6 and 7 to be applied only against the retaining means 9 if means are used to exert a vertical force F under each flap. It will be understood therefore that the friction surface between flap and box is greatly reduced if it is compared to the friction surface that is seen in the documents cited. As a result, opening the flap will be easier and will require less manual energy.
  • the ball 10 travels under the flap (see also figure 5 ) a path 12 whose ends are hollowed with a first housing 13 and a second housing 14 in which the ball 10 is able to partially penetrate to respectively notch the flap 6 in its open and closed positions.
  • the ball 10 in the open position of the flap 6, the ball 10 is in the housing 13.
  • the ball 10 leaves its housing 13 and moves along the path 12 until it falls into the housing 14 which marks the closure of the shutter. It will be noted here that when falling in the housing 13 or 14, the ball 10 sounds a click that warns the wearer of the end of an operation at the same time it gives him the impression of having a neat building object .
  • the ball 10 is made of hard material and preferably ceramic. Such a choice ensures a very long life of the mechanism before there appear signs of weakness manifested by hard points or scratches during the opening or closing movements of the shutters.
  • each flap 6 and 7 on the box 1 will be described below.
  • these retaining means 9 comprise at least two cylindrical pins 15 and 16 whose ends emerge on either side of a listel 17 integral with the box 1, and two grooves 18 and 19 formed in the flap 6 and located in on either side of the strip 17, grooves in which are engaged the ends of the pins 15 and 16.
  • the groove 18 may consist of a rail 20 attached under the flap 6 by means of screws 34 and the groove 19 consisting of a rail 21 attached under the flap 6 by means of screws 35.
  • the guide means 8 guiding each flap 6 and 7 on the side on which it is retained are shown on the figures 4 , 5 and 6 .
  • These guide means comprise two rails 22 and 23 emerging from the box 1, each of these rails being engaged in a groove 24, respectively 25, formed in the flap 6. It is clear here that the guide means 8 are independent and therefore distinct from the retaining means 9 previously described.
  • the end of the strand 2 of the bracelet is traversed by two screws 26 whose heads 40 rest on a transverse bar 41.
  • the screws 26 pass through said bar 41 and the end of the strand 2 to be screwed into a boss 42 of the box 1.
  • the boss 42 has a thread 43 in which the screw 26 is screwed.
  • the screw 26 ends with an end or extension 27 which emerges from the box 1 and engages in a milling 28 formed in the flap 6 to limit the stroke of the flap and prevent it from emerging from the box.

Claims (10)

  1. Armbanduhr mit im Wesentlichen rechtwinkliger Form, die ein ein Uhrwerk umgebendes Gehäuse (1), ein Armband, wovon ein erster Bandabschnitt (2) an einer ersten Seite (3) des Gehäuses befestigt ist und wovon ein zweiter Bandabschnitt (4) an einer zweiten Seite (5) gegenüber der ersten Seite befestigt ist, und zwei Klappen (6, 7), die an dem Gehäuse gleiten und geöffnet oder geschlossen werden können, um das Gehäuse durch eine auf diese Klappen ausgeübte manuelle Betätigung sichtbar zu machen oder zu verbergen, umfasst, wobei Führungsmittel (8) und Haltemittel (9) verwendet werden, um jede der Klappen an dem Gehäuse zu befestigen, dadurch gekennzeichnet, dass die Führungsmittel (8) und die Haltemittel (9) voneinander verschieden sind und dass Mittel verwendet werden, um unter jeder der Klappen eine vertikale Kraft (F) auszuüben, die bestrebt ist, die Klappe (6, 7) gegen die Haltemittel (9) zu drängen.
  2. Armbanduhr nach Anspruch 1, dadurch gekennzeichnet, dass die Mittel, die verwendet werden, um die vertikale Kraft (F) auszuüben, aus einer Kugel (10) bestehen, die unter jeder der Klappen (6, 7) angeordnet ist, wobei diese Kugel mit dem Gehäuse fest verbunden und durch eine Feder (11) weggedrückt wird.
  3. Armbanduhr nach Anspruch 2, dadurch gekennzeichnet, dass jede der Kugeln (10) aus einem harten Material, insbesondere aus Keramik, hergestellt ist.
  4. Armbanduhr nach Anspruch 1, dadurch gekennzeichnet, dass die Kugel (10) unter der Klappe (6, 7) auf einem Weg (12) läuft, dessen Enden durch einen ersten Aufnahmesitz (13) und einen zweiten Aufnahmesitz (14) vertieft sind, in die die Kugel jeweils teilweise eindringen kann, um die Klappe in ihrer geöffneten bzw. ihrer geschlossenen Position einzurasten.
  5. Armbanduhr nach Anspruch 1, dadurch gekennzeichnet, dass die Haltemittel (9) jeder der Klappen (6, 7) an dem Gehäuse (1) wenigstens zwei zylindrische Stifte (15, 16) umfassen, deren Enden von beiden Seiten einer mit dem Gehäuse fest verbundenen Leiste (17) ausgehen, und zwei Nuten (18, 19) umfassen, die in der Klappe ausgebildet sind und sich beiderseits der Leiste befinden, wobei in den Nuten die Enden der Stifte in Eingriff sind.
  6. Armbanduhr nach Anspruch 5, dadurch gekennzeichnet, dass jede der Nuten (18, 19) aus einer unter der Klappe (6, 7) angefügten Schiene (20, 21) gebildet ist.
  7. Armbanduhr nach Anspruch 5, dadurch gekennzeichnet, dass jeder Stift (15, 16) in der Leiste (17) durch eine Dichtung aus elastischem Material gehalten wird.
  8. Armbanduhr nach Anspruch 1, dadurch gekennzeichnet, dass die Führungsmittel (8) zwei Schienen (22, 23) umfassen, die von dem Gehäuse (1) ausgehen, wobei jede dieser Schienen in einer in der Klappe (6, 7) ausgebildeten Nut (24, 25) in Eingriff ist.
  9. Armbanduhr nach Anspruch 1, dadurch gekennzeichnet, dass der erste Bandabschnitt (2) und der zweite Bandabschnitt (4) des Armbandes in dem Gehäuse (1) mittels Schrauben (26) befestigt sind, die gemeinsam verwendet werden, um zu verhindern, dass sich die Klappe (6, 7) von dem Gehäuse löst, und um die Bahn der Klappe zu begrenzen.
  10. Armbanduhr nach Anspruch 9, dadurch gekennzeichnet, dass das Ende (27) jeder der Schrauben (26) in einer Ausfräsung (28), die in der Klappe (6, 7) ausgebildet ist, in Eingriff ist.
